Just Eat Takeaway is a leading online food delivery marketplace, connecting consumers and restaurants through its platform in 22 countries. We're hiring a Delivery Rider to transport meals from restaurants to customers, ensuring timely and accurate deliveries. This role creates impact by supporting local businesses and customers in the UK with a fully flexible, onsite work mode.
Key Responsibilities:
- Use a car to navigate city streets efficiently, leveraging smartphone apps (Android 8.0+/iOS 12+) to manage delivery routes and ensure on-time arrivals.
- Maintain high standards of service by verifying order accuracy, handling payments if required, and providing a professional experience to customers.
- Adapt to dynamic schedules, optimizing delivery routes to maximize earnings and customer satisfaction during peak and off-peak hours.
